Compartir por


MimeReturnReader Clase

Definición

Proporciona una implementación base común para los lectores de valores devueltos de respuesta entrantes para los clientes de servicio web implementados mediante HTTP, pero sin SOAP.

public ref class MimeReturnReader abstract : System::Web::Services::Protocols::MimeFormatter
public abstract class MimeReturnReader : System.Web.Services.Protocols.MimeFormatter
type MimeReturnReader = class
    inherit MimeFormatter
Public MustInherit Class MimeReturnReader
Inherits MimeFormatter
Herencia
MimeReturnReader
Derivado

Comentarios

MimeReturnReader y otras clases del System.Web.Services.Protocols espacio de nombres admiten las implementaciones de servicios web de .NET Framework a través de las operaciones de HTTP-GET y HTTP-POST. Los lectores y escritores de servicios web serializan y deserializan, respectivamente, entre los parámetros o devuelven objetos de métodos Web y las secuencias de solicitud o respuesta HTTP. Los lectores y escritores de servicios web usan HTTP para el transporte, pero no intercambian mensajes mediante el estándar SOAP.

La MimeReturnReader clase establece una interfaz común Read para todas las lecturas del lado cliente de flujos de respuesta HTTP en valores devueltos del método web.

Normalmente, no es necesario usar MimeReturnReader ni sus clases descendientes directamente. En su lugar, cuando la herramienta Wsdl.exe genera código de proxy de cliente según las implementaciones de HTTP-GET o HTTP-POST, aplica a HttpMethodAttribute cada método web y establece la propiedad del ReturnFormatter atributo en la XmlReturnReader clase , que se deriva de MimeReturnReader.

Constructores

Nombre Description
MimeReturnReader()

Inicializa una nueva instancia de la clase MimeReturnReader.

Métodos

Nombre Description
Equals(Object)

Determina si el objeto especificado es igual al objeto actual.

(Heredado de Object)
GetHashCode()

Actúa como función hash predeterminada.

(Heredado de Object)
GetInitializer(LogicalMethodInfo)

Cuando se invalida en una clase derivada, devuelve un inicializador para el método especificado.

(Heredado de MimeFormatter)
GetInitializers(LogicalMethodInfo[])

Cuando se reemplaza en una clase derivada, devuelve una matriz de objetos de inicializador correspondientes a una matriz de entrada de definiciones de método.

(Heredado de MimeFormatter)
GetType()

Obtiene el Type de la instancia actual.

(Heredado de Object)
Initialize(Object)

Cuando se invalida en una clase derivada, inicializa una instancia.

(Heredado de MimeFormatter)
MemberwiseClone()

Crea una copia superficial del Objectactual.

(Heredado de Object)
Read(WebResponse, Stream)

Cuando se invalida en una clase derivada, deserializa una respuesta HTTP en un valor devuelto del método web.

ToString()

Devuelve una cadena que representa el objeto actual.

(Heredado de Object)

Se aplica a

Consulte también